|
Leases (Details) - Schedule of leases by balance sheet location - USD ($)
|
Dec. 31, 2021
|
Dec. 31, 2020
|Schedule of leases by balance sheet location [Abstract]
|Operating lease right-of-use assets, continuing operations
|Operating lease assets
|Operating lease right-of-use assets, continuing operations
|Operating lease right-of-use assets, discontinued operations
|Operating lease assets
|Operating lease right-of-use assets, discontinued operations
|$ 62,397
|183,409
|Total operating lease right-of-use assets
|$ 62,397
|183,409
|Operating lease liability – current, continuing operations
|Current operating lease liabilities
|Operating lease liability – current, continuing operations
|Operating lease liability – current, discontinued operations
|Current operating lease liabilities
|Operating lease liability – current, discontinued operations
|$ 62,397
|72,367
|Total operating lease liability – current
|$ 62,397
|72,367
|Operating lease liability – non-current, continuing operations
|Long-term operating lease liabilities
|Operating lease liability – non-current, continuing operations
|Operating lease liability – non-current, discontinued operations
|Long-term operating lease liabilities
|Operating lease liability – non-current, discontinued operations
|103,379
|Total operating lease liability – non-current
|103,379
|Total lease liabilities – continuing operations
|Total lease liabilities – discontinued operations
|$ 62,397
|$ 175,746
|X
- Definition
+ References
Operating lease liability – current, continuing operations.
+ Details
No definition available.
|X
- Definition
+ References
Operating lease liability – current, continuing operations.
+ Details
No definition available.
|X
- Definition
+ References
Operating lease liability – current, discontinued operations.
+ Details
No definition available.
|X
- Definition
+ References
Operating lease liability – current, discontinued operations.
+ Details
No definition available.
|X
- Definition
+ References
Operating lease liability – non-current, continuing operations.
+ Details
No definition available.
|X
- Definition
+ References
Operating lease liability – non-current, continuing operations.
+ Details
No definition available.
|X
- Definition
+ References
Operating lease liability – non-current, discontinued operations.
+ Details
No definition available.
|X
- Definition
+ References
Operating lease liability – non-current, discontinued operations.
+ Details
No definition available.
|X
- Definition
+ References
Operating lease right-of-use assets, continuing operations.
+ Details
No definition available.
|X
- Definition
+ References
Operating lease right-of-use assets, continuing operations.
+ Details
No definition available.
|X
- Definition
+ References
Operating lease right-of-use assets, discontinued operations
+ Details
No definition available.
|X
- Definition
+ References
Operating lease right-of-use assets, discontinued operations.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Total lease liabilities – continuing operations.
+ Details
No definition available.
|X
- Definition
+ References
Total lease liabilities – discontinued operations.
+ Details
No definition available.
|X
- Definition
+ References
Total operating lease liability – current.
+ Details
No definition available.
|X
- Definition
+ References
Total operating lease liability – non-current.
+ Details
No definition available.
|X
- Definition
+ References
Total operating lease right-of-use assets.
+ Details
No definition available.